Abstract

A battery module and a method for cooling the battery module are provided. The battery module includes a housing having an electrically non-conductive oil disposed therein, and a battery cell disposed in the housing that contacts the electrically non-conductive oil. The battery module further includes first and second heat conductive fins disposed in the housing that contacts the electrically non-conductive oil. The first and second heat conductive fins extract heat energy from the electrically non-conductive oil. The battery module further includes first and second conduits extending through the first and second heat conductive fins, respectively. The first and second conduits receive first and second portions of a fluid, respectively, therethrough and conduct heat energy from the first and second heat conductive fins, respectively, into the fluid to cool the battery cell.
